Davie vs Coral Springs Florida
Davie and Coral Springs are both solid Broward County choices for families relocating to South Florida in 2026. They are not the same place. One is a planned suburban city with polished parks and top-rated schools. The other is a semi-rural town with horse trails, larger lots, and a character you cannot manufacture.
Here is how they actually compare.
How Do Home Prices Compare Between Davie and Coral Springs?
Coral Springs carries a slightly higher median price than Davie, but the gap is not dramatic. Davie offers more land per dollar, particularly on properties with half-acre or larger lots. Buyers with $500,000 to $600,000 will find more square footage and more outdoor space in Davie than in a comparable Coral Springs listing.
According to a January 2026 market report published on ActiveRain, Coral Springs closed 118 single-family homes in January 2026, up 25.5% from 94 closings in January 2025, with a median sale price of $585,000. Days on market rose 50% to 78 days, which signals buyers have more negotiating room than they did a year ago. Active inventory dropped 15% to 892 listings, so supply is tighter than it looks.
Davie does not yet have a comparable January 2026 data set published at the same level of detail. What is consistent across both markets is that South Florida pricing has not softened meaningfully. Budget-conscious buyers should not wait for a correction that the data does not support.
Which City Is Safer, Davie or Coral Springs?
Coral Springs has the stronger safety reputation among Broward County suburban communities. What I see consistently in working this market is that buyers relocating from out of state perceive Coral Springs as the more controlled, lower-crime environment, and that perception is reflected in how families prioritize it during their search. Both towns are suburban and family-oriented, and neither has the crime profile of an urban core.
The safety difference is real but should be weighed against the full picture of what each town offers. Buyers who want the most buttoned-up suburban environment in Broward County tend to land in Coral Springs. Buyers who are comfortable in a more open, semi-rural setting find Davie fits without reservation.
Are Schools Better in Davie or Coral Springs?
Both towns are served by Broward County Public Schools, the same district, the same accountability framework, and the same rating system. Coral Springs has a higher concentration of schools that consistently rank near the top of district ratings. Davie schools are competitive and solid, but not uniformly ranked at the same level.
Families prioritizing access to the highest-rated elementary and middle schools in the district will find more of them concentrated in Coral Springs. Davie still offers strong public school options, and several private and charter schools operate within or near town limits. Buyers with school-age children should verify specific school zones using the BCPS school finder before committing to a neighborhood.
What Is the Lifestyle Difference Between Davie and Coral Springs?
Coral Springs was master-planned. The streets are clean, the parks are maintained, and the neighborhoods have a consistent, organized feel. Davie was not built that way, and that is the point.
The Town of Davie permits horses on residential properties and allows road riding in designated areas. You will find working ranches, equestrian communities, and half-acre lots within 20 minutes of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port. That combination does not exist in Coral Springs.
Davie attracts buyers who want space without leaving South Florida. Coral Springs attracts buyers who want a polished suburban environment with strong community infrastructure. Both are legitimate preferences. They are just different ones.
How Do Commutes Compare From Davie vs Coral Springs?
Both towns sit in central Broward County with access to major highways. Davie connects directly to I-595, which feeds into I-95 and the Florida Turnpike. Coral Springs sits farther northwest, with primary access via the Sawgrass Expressway.
For commuters heading to Fort Lauderdale or Miami, Davie has a geographic edge. The drive to downtown Fort Lauderdale from Davie runs roughly 15 to 20 minutes under normal traffic conditions. Coral Springs adds approximately 10 to 15 minutes depending on origin point and traffic, though both estimates vary with conditions. For buyers commuting daily, that difference compounds over time.

Should I Buy in Davie or Coral Springs Right Now?
The 2026 data points toward a market that rewards preparation. According to the January 2026 Coral Springs market report published on ActiveRain, active inventory is down 15% year over year and failed listings are up 28%, from 89 to 114. That combination means some sellers are overpriced and some buyers are finding real opportunities. Davie is operating in the same broader South Florida market with similar dynamics.
Buyers who know exactly what they want, have financing in order, and are working with someone who understands the local inventory will be in a better position than buyers who are still researching in six months. The market is not crashing. It is also not getting cheaper.

Does Davie allow horses?
Yes. The Town of Davie permits horses on residential properties in designated areas and allows road riding in specific zones. This is one of the defining characteristics that separates Davie from every other town in Broward County.
